Prosecutors blast latest ‘PD Diary’ beef episode

Prosecutors yesterday condemned MBC for airing a “PD Diary” episode devoted to the broadcaster’s arguments over the controversy surrounding the U.S. beef imports while an ongoing court battle remains to be settled.

“Ahead of an appeals trial, MBC, where the accused are employed, aired an episode of its own arguments using airwaves, which are public property,” the Seoul Central District Prosecutors’ Office said in a press release. “We are extremely upset by MBC’s action.”

PD Diary, a current affairs program, aired an episode on Tuesday about the acquittal of its five staffers. On Jan. 20, the Seoul Central District Court acquitted four producers and a scriptwriter of charges that they defamed government officials and obstructed the business of U.S. beef importers by broadcasting controversial PD Diary episodes about mad cow disease in 2008. Following a one-year investigation, prosecutors concluded last June that the MBC staff members deliberately created a biased report about the safety of U.S. beef and the risk of its being infected with mad cow disease. In the process, prosecutors said, the station defamed then-Agriculture Minister Chung Woon-chun and Min Dong-seok, former deputy minister and chief negotiator on the U.S. beef import deal. After MBC staff members were acquitted, prosecutors immediately filed an appeal.

It took less than a week for the PD Diary to strike back. The new episode, titled “PD Diary acquitted in the initial criminal trial,” was aired Tuesday night, reporting on evidence that served as the basis of the ruling. Enraged prosecutors defended the indictments and their decision to appeal.

“The accused refused to submit key evidence during the initial trial, hiding under the justification of protecting sources,” prosecutors said in the statement. “They only selected data that are favorable to them and created a new episode. Instead of airing another biased report, they should submit the raw data to the appeals court to lay bare the truth.”

Prosecutors said they had carefully reviewed evidence before filing the indictments, but the court acquitted the accused after interpreting the evidence in a completely different light. “That was why we had filed the appeal,” prosecutors said, adding that they would do their best to serve the public by seeking a reasonable verdict during the appeals trial.
